Ingredients
- 2 1/2 pounds ground beef
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 1 1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
- 2 teaspoons ground cumin
- 3 tablespoons chili powder
- 1/2 teaspoon crushed red pepper
- 1 teaspoon ground allspice
- 1 tablespoon salt
- 1 medium onion, finely chopped
- 4 cloves garlic, crushed
- 1 can (12 ounce) tomato paste
- 1 can (15 ounce) tomato sauce
- 4 cups water
- 2 tablespoons vinegar
- 2 teaspoons worcestershire sauce (optional)
- 4 bay leaves
- 1 ounce block unsweetened baking chocolate
- 1/2 teaspoon ground cayenne peppers (optional)
Description
Since I Now Live In Cincinnati, I Thought It Was About Time I Added A Recipe For A Local Staple! Cincinnati Chili Actually Was Inspired By Greek Immigrants (no Wonder I Tend To Like This Style Of Chili - Since I Love Mediterannean Cuisine!).
